    Penticton Regional Airport (IATA: YYF, ICAO: CYYF) is a regional airport located in Penticton, British Columbia, Canada. It is owned and operated by the Penticton Airport Authority.     SS Sicamous Heritage Park is home to a famous museum that will help you understand maritime history. The ship that is known as the largest surviving paddle wheeler in Canada was launched in 1914.     Bench 1775 Winery is a small place that is full of surprises. Their beautiful vineyard is spread over 30 acres and overlooks the Okanagan Lake. You will find their award-winning wines at the tasting room that is located on Naramata Road. Their 2014 Merlot and Paradise Ranch 2014 Sauvignon Blanc VQA Ice-wine are a must try.

    Loco Landing is a family-owned amusement park in Penticton. From go-karts to bumper boats and from mini-golf to rock-climbing, it has everything on the premises.
